Originally released in 1977. Oh, God! is a fantasy/comedy film. directed by Carl Reiner.

Starring John Denver, George Burns, and Teri Garr

Synopsis

When God appears to an assistant grocery manager as a good natured old man, the Almighty selects him as his messenger for the modern world.
